WebJun 3, 2024 · Signs of Dutch rule in New York City remain, however. Brooklyn and Harlem are named for Dutch towns, for instance. And, the flag of New York City is a tricolor of blue, white, and orange with the city’s seal, which displays 1625 (the founding of New Amsterdam, as we saw) and a Dutch windmill, among other symbols.
